Grants of early termination of HSR waiting period temporarily suspended by DOJ and FTC – merging parties should expect to wait the full 30 days until further announcement

The Federal Trade Commission ("FTC") and Department of Justice ("DOJ") announced today that they are temporarily suspending any grants of early termination under the Hart-Scott-Rodino Act ("HSR Act").
